Former Arsenal defender Bacary Sagna has launched a staunch defence of 'amazing' Gunners striker Alexandre Lacazette. Lacazette has copped some criticism from the Emirates faithful for his displays this season, managing just seven goals in 20 Premier League outings so far.
He was voted Arsenal's player of the year in 2018-19 but has failed to earn the same plaudits this term with the Londoners sitting ninth in the Premier League and out of Europe.
